KELYA SALLI ELCHIKERi / RAW BANANA SKIN CURRY [KONKANI RECIPE].
The following ingredients are needed to prepare the Kelya Salli Elchikeri / Raw Banana Skin Curry.
Ingredients:-
Raw Nendran Banana Skin. - from 2 Bananas
Green gram( Mugu). - 3/4 cup
Yam. - a small piece
Dry Mango piece (Ambya Sol). - a small piece
For grinding the Coconut Masala Paste:-
Grated Coconut. -1cup
Dry Red Chillies. -5 or 6
Turmeric powder. -1/4tsp
For Seasoning:-
Coconut oil. -1tsp
Mustard seeds. -1/2tsp
Cumin seeds. -1/2tsp
Curry leaves. -1 spring.
For roasted Coconut gratings:-
Coconut oil. -1/2tsp
Coconut grating. -1/4 cup
Instructions:-
1. Wash and soak Green gram (Mugu) for 6 hours or overnight and keep aside.
2. Chop both the ends of the raw Nendran Banana and take the raw Banana Skin with a knife and keep aside the Banana Skin on a plate.
3. Peel the outer thin green layer of the raw Nendran Banana Skin and chop the raw Banana Skin into small pieces and keep aside.
4. Chop the Yam into small pieces. Wash 2/3 times in water and keep aside.
5. Grind the grated Coconut, dry Red chillies and Turmeric powder to a smooth paste without adding water and keep aside.
6. In a pressure cooker add the soaked Green gram, chopped Raw Banana Skin and chopped Yam pieces adding required water for 2 whisles or till cooked and keep aside.
Method:-
1. In a cooking pan add the cooked Green gram, raw Banana skin and Yam cubes and boil well.
2. Add Salt and dry Mango pieces and mix well. Boil for 2 minutes on low flame.
3. Add ground Coconut Masala Paste and mix well.
4. Boil for 3 minutes on low flame and switch off the flame.
5. Heat 1tsp Coconut oil or Cooking oil in a pan for seasoning and splutter Mustard seeds and Cumin seeds and saute well. Add Curry leaves and fry well.
6. Switch off the flame and add the above seasoning into the Curry in the cooking pan.
7. Heat 1/2tsp Coconut oil in the same pan and roast Coconut grating until golden brown colour and switch off the flame.
8. Add the roasted Coconut gratings into the Curry in the cooking pan amd mix well.
9. Transfer the Raw banana Skin Curry to a serving bowl.
10. A tasty and delicious Kelya Salli Elchikeri / Raw Banana Skin Curry is ready to serve with Rice.
